Car history:
My father, Wes Bontrager owned this car from 02/22/1962 till 02/10/1965 when he lived and worked in Evanston IL while doing 1W service at the local hospital. After that was completed he stayed and found full time employment. While parked on the side of the street in front of their apartment, he pulled the OEM cam and installed a high rise cam. This car was painted a forest green with white bullet. I believe that green was not an OEM color for this year.

A group of young men from Haven / Yoder Kansas were placed in Evanston IL for their selective service / 1W program giving a year or more worth of their labor.

He purchased this car from Joe Jacobs Chevrolet in Wilmette IL for $2,595.00
He traded this car in at Humphry Chevrolet in Evanston IL for $1,685.05
